The Importance of Submersible Water Pumps for Fish Tanks


Maintaining a healthy environment for fish is crucial for any aquarium enthusiast, and one of the essential components that contribute to this environment is a reliable water pump. Among various types of pumps available in the market, submersible water pumps are particularly favored for fish tanks due to their efficiency, versatility, and ease of use. In this article, we will explore the significance of submersible water pumps in fish tanks, their workings, benefits, and tips for choosing the right one.


What is a Submersible Water Pump?


A submersible water pump is designed to operate while submerged in water. It consists of a sealed casing containing a motor, which makes it ideal for tasks such as moving water from one place to another, filtering, and aerating the water in fish tanks. These pumps are usually placed at the bottom of the aquarium, which minimizes noise and keeps the aesthetic of the tank intact.


Key Benefits of Using Submersible Pumps in Fish Tanks


1. Effective Water Circulation One of the primary functions of a water pump in a fish tank is to ensure effective water circulation. This is vital as stagnant water can lead to the build-up of harmful toxins and bacteria. A submersible pump keeps the water moving, ensuring that all areas of the tank receive adequate filtration and aeration.


2. Space-Saving Design Because submersible pumps are installed below the water surface, they save space and do not disrupt the visual appeal of the aquarium setup. This design is particularly beneficial for small or intricately decorated tanks where visibility and space are critical.


3. Reduced Noise Levels Unlike external pumps that can be quite loud, submersible pumps operate quietly while submerged. This feature is especially beneficial for home environments where noise may disturb both inhabitants and aquatic life.


4. Energy Efficiency Submersible water pumps are often designed for energy efficiency, helping aquarium owners reduce electricity costs. They are typically easy to install and maintain, which makes them a great choice for both beginners and experienced aquarists.

5. Versatility Submersible pumps come in various sizes and flow rates, making them suitable for different types and sizes of fish tanks. Whether you have a small aquarium with freshwater fish or a large marine tank with corals and live rock, there’s a submersible pump that will meet your needs.


Choosing the Right Submersible Pump


When selecting a submersible water pump for your fish tank, consider the following factors


- Tank Size The pump’s flow rate should be compatible with the size of your aquarium. A general rule of thumb is that the pump should circulate the entire volume of water in your tank at least 4-5 times per hour.


- Type of Fish Different fish species have varying needs when it comes to water movement. For example, some prefer gentle currents, while others thrive in strong water flow. Make sure to choose a pump that caters to the specific requirements of your aquatic pets.


- Maintenance and Durability Look for models that are easy to maintain. A pump made from durable materials will ensure longevity, reducing the need for frequent replacements and repairs.


- Additional Features Some pumps come with built-in filters and built-in lighting, which can enhance the appearance of your aquarium and improve its overall functionality.
